系统边界图的定义:
系统边界图是系统工程和软件工程中的一种图形化工具,用于描述系统与外部世界之间的交互和界限。它展示了系统的组成部分以及这些组件如何与外部实体进行通信和交互。系统边界图通常包括系统内部的各个组件、外部实体以及它们之间的通信路径和数据流动。这种图形化的表示方式能够帮助开发人员和利益相关者更清晰地理解系统的结构和功能,有助于指导系统设计、开发和测试工作。
系统边界图的要素:
一般来说,系统边界图包括以下几个要素:
-
系统组件:系统的各个组成部分,通常以方框或圆圈表示。这些组件可以是软件模块、硬件设备或其他实体。
-
外部实体:与系统进行交互的外部元素,比如用户、其他系统、设备等。外部实体通常用箭头表示与系统之间的交互。
-
界限:表示系统与外部实体之间的边界,标志着系统的范围和责任。
-
通信路径:描述系统组件之间以及系统与外部实体之间的通信路径,通常用箭头表示。
-
数据流:表示信息或数据在系统内部和外部实体之间的流动路径。
系统边界图的创建步骤:
创建系统边界图的过程通常涉及以下步骤:
-
确定系统范围:明确系统的功能和边界,确定需要包含在系统边界图中的所有组件和外部实体。
-
识别组件和实体:识别系统内部的各个组件以及与系统交互的外部实体。
-
绘制边界:绘制系统边界,标明系统的范围。
-
连接组件和实体:使用箭头表示组件之间的通信路径,以及系统与外部实体之间的交互。
-
标注信息流:添加数据流以描述信息在系统内部和外部实体之间的传递路径。
-
验证和完善:检查系统边界图,确保它清晰地描述了系统的结构和交互,同时完善任何可能存在的遗漏或错误。
系统边界图是系统设计和分析的重要工具,能够帮助开发人员和利益相关者更好地理解系统的结构和功能,并指导后续的开发和测试工作。
系统边界图案例:
更多消息资讯,请访问昂焱数据。